首页 新闻 会员 周边 捐助

请程序员朋友们帮我解答一下这个问题

0
悬赏园豆:10 [已解决问题] 解决于 2013-05-29 22:18

我打算考软件设计师,目前用的是C#语言,但是据说现在软考只能在C++和java之间选(C好像取消了?是吗?),我想知道C++语言和java语言各有哪些优势,因为这2个都没有接触过,麻烦用过的朋友告诉我一下,分别列出来,最好把发展方向也写下。谢谢!

另外顺便问一下,C#语言开发效率那么高,软考为什么不把它也列出选择范围呢?谢谢!

hexllo的主页 hexllo | 菜鸟二级 | 园豆:318
提问于:2013-05-19 09:56
< >
分享
最佳答案
0

   是的,软考的下午的程序题只有C++和JAVA,没有C#,其实很简单的,你只要懂得C#,那C++和JAVA也是差不了多少的。每个语言都有优秀的,最重要的是你自己要学得精就行了。现在来说,JAVA还是比较热门的,如果你打算在Android方面发展的话,可以考虑一下JAVA,如果你想向高级编程方面发展可以学一下C++。

  

收获园豆:5
繒經最羙 | 初学一级 |园豆:178 | 2013-05-19 10:34
其他回答(8)
0

考试的话,建议用java,类似C#,写起来方便些

收获园豆:2
励马 | 园豆:67 (初学一级) | 2013-05-19 15:49
0

就目前的市场来看,java的市场占有率很大,其实C# 和java有很多相同的地方,都没有指针,都采用垃圾回收机制等等,C++的话一般应用高级编程,有些设计底层的东西。建议你还是学java吧。

收获园豆:3
灭龙魔法师 | 园豆:119 (初学一级) | 2013-05-19 17:34
0

考毛的软考,我面试了三四十家公司,从来没有人问过我是否考过软考

朝曦 | 园豆:1073 (小虾三级) | 2013-05-19 18:18
0

楼上真牛,面试了那么多公司

itmania | 园豆:206 (菜鸟二级) | 2013-05-20 17:08
0

C++和java都是面向对象开发,他们的不同在于,c++是基于c语言的,所以保留了c语言的指针特性,而java中无指针。还有就是c++面向于底层些。C#虽然开发效率高,但市场有限,编写的软件可移植性差,不像java可以跨平台

cel | 园豆:380 (菜鸟二级) | 2013-05-21 10:09
0

我只想知道楼主为什么想考这个

在大地画满窗子 | 园豆:102 (初学一级) | 2013-05-21 17:52
0

真心没用 。。

哇~怪兽 | 园豆:622 (小虾三级) | 2013-05-23 12:15
0

Java开发四五年了,建议你用Java

jinze | 园豆:227 (菜鸟二级) | 2013-05-28 17:34
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册